HONOURABLE SRI JUSTICE P.NAVEEN RAO ORDER:

Petitioners claim that they purchased the land to an extent of Ac.1.07 guntas in Sy.No.588/EU and Ac.0.21 guntas in Sy.No.588/EE of Kondapur village through registered sale deeds. However, it was found that third person has laid fencing in the land purchased by the petitioners. In order to resolve the issue, representation was made to the Assistant Director of Survey and Land Records on 30.08.2019 requesting him to conduct survey. Alleging inaction on the said representation, this Writ Petition is filed. 2.

According to the procedure evolved by the Government, initially the authority to order survey is the Tahsildar of concerned mandal and as per the directions of the Tahsildar, the Mandal Surveyor has to conduct survey. The application for conducting survey has to be submitted in F-line mode through Online web portal and not in physical form. That being so, petitioner submitted application in physical form addressed to the Assistant Director of Survey and Land Records, who is not competent. Therefore, it cannot be said that respondents are negligent in not acting upon the request of petitioner warranting interference by this Court.

3.

Granting liberty to petitioner to make an application as required to conduct survey, Writ Petition is disposed of. Pending miscellaneous petitions shall stand closed.
